What is the Reverse Side of Paper Ballot?

The reverse side of a paper ballot is an essential component of the ballot used in U.S. elections. It features critical elements such as voter assistance certification and the initials of election inspectors, which contribute to transparency in the electoral process. The inclusion of these components not only aids in ensuring accountability but also reinforces the integrity of the voting system.
This section of the ballot serves as a safeguard, verifying that proper procedures are followed, which is crucial for maintaining voter confidence in election outcomes.

Who Needs the Reverse Side of Paper Ballot?

This form is essential for voters who require assistance during the voting process and for the assistors tasked with helping them. Various scenarios exist where individuals may need to use this form, such as when navigating complexities in the ballot or addressing language barriers. It is utilized across different municipalities in the U.S. to ensure that voters receive the support they need.
